Frequently Asked Questions About NULLpointer
FAQPage SchemaWhat specific security tasks can be performed using these capabilities?▼
These capabilities enable comprehensive security assessments including threat modeling via PASTA, Active Directory lateral movement analysis, TLS/SSL configuration auditing, and automated vulnerability research. Users can map internal networks, perform OSINT, and generate structured remediation patches or CVE request packages directly from identified security findings.
Which technical personas benefit most from these security modules?▼
These modules are designed for penetration testers, security researchers, and infrastructure engineers. Professionals tasked with hardening cloud environments, conducting red team exercises, or ensuring compliance with ASVS 5.0 standards will find these functions essential for identifying, validating, and documenting security vulnerabilities within complex enterprise systems.
What are the prerequisites for running these security assessment modules?▼
Execution requires a local environment capable of handling JSON-based findings and standard security testing frameworks. Specific modules depend on access to target infrastructure, such as cloud provider credentials for infrastructure auditing, or a containerized environment for validating exploits via Metasploit and generating Burp Suite request payloads.
